How they compare
Russian Federation currently reports 143,362 1000 USD against 112,430 1000 USD in Saudi Arabia, a difference of 30,932 1000 USD.
That makes Russian Federation's figure about 1.3 times Saudi Arabia's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 22 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Russian Federation ahead.
Russian Federation ranks 12th and Saudi Arabia ranks 15th of 156 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Russian Federation averaged higher in 2 and Saudi Arabia in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Russian Federation | Saudi Arabia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 2,199 1000 USD | 1,968 1000 USD | 231 1000 USD | Russian Federation |
| 2000s | 28,654 1000 USD | 14,910 1000 USD | 13,744 1000 USD | Russian Federation |
| 2010s | 100,654 1000 USD | 137,817 1000 USD | 37,164 1000 USD | Saudi Arabia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
